How much do hydraulic press oper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for hydraulic press operator in the United States is $18.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$20.67 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a hydraulic press operator do?

A Hydraulic Press Operator sets up, operates, and maintains hydraulic press machines to shape, form, or compress materials like metal, plastic, or composites. They adjust pressure settings, inspect finished products for quality, and ensure machines run efficiently and safely. Operators also perform routine maintenance and troubleshoot issues to minimize downtime. Accuracy, attention to detail, and adherence to safety protocols are essential skills in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a hydraulic press operator?

To thrive as a Hydraulic Press Operator, you need m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, often supplemented by experience in machine operation or manufacturing. Familiarity with hydraulic press machines, safety protocols, measurement instruments, and sometimes OSHA certification is important. Strong problem-solving skills, reliability, and effective teamwork help individuals excel in this role. These abilities are critical for ensuring efficient production, minimizing downtime, and maintaining a safe work environment.

Job description

We are seeking Press Operators to operate mechanical and hydraulic stamping presses producing metal components. We have 2nd and 3rd shifts available. This role is responsible for operating press equipment, inspecting parts, and maintaining production and quality standards in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.

Responsibilities
• Operate mechanical and/or hydraulic stamping presses to produce metal parts
• Load materials and monitor press operations during production runs
• Perform basic machine setup and adjustments as needed
• Inspect finished parts using calipers, micrometers, and gauges
• Read blueprints and follow work instructions
• Maintain production documentation and quality records
• Follow all safety procedures and maintain a clean work area

Qualifications
• Previous experience operating stamping presses or similar metal forming equipment
• Ability to read blueprints and use precision measuring tools
• Strong mechanical aptitude and attention to detail
• Ability to stand for extended periods and lift up to 40–50 lbs
• Reliable attendance and ability to work assigned shift

Nice to Have
• Experience with progressive dies or coil-fed stamping presses
• Experience in a high-volume metal manufacturing environment
